If a DeKalb Tech graduate or their employer sees a need to file a claim under the Technical Education Warranty, they should submit a written request to the Vice President of Academic Affairs with the following information:
The Vice President of Academic Affairs will review the claim. If approved, the student and/or faculty member and the Registrar will be notified. The Registrar will register the student with the coding approved by the Data Center, notify the Financial Aid/Business Office and the IT Department.
If denied, the Vice President of Academic Affairs will notify the student and/or faculty member. The Technical Education Warranty applies to any DeKalb Technical College graduate who is employed in the field of his/her training and is in effect for a period of two years after graduation.
